How much oxytocin did you give. Sometimes small dosages over a period of time works better. As far as bucket feeding a foal, try to get the foal sucking on your fingers and then lead them into the bucket. Be persistent, sometimes it takes many times for them to get the idea. Good luck.
Sometimes they don't come into milk, no matter what you give them. Get a Nursemare if you can. Thats the best way to raise foal. The bucket will work, but there are other factors to consider. The foal will need a companion, another foal if possable. You will need to monator the foal. Feed a good Milk replacer, Buckeye,Blue seal, landolakes. No foalac.They hate the taste. We feed twice a day. Give a good foal sarter and some good quality hay. A little Alphi won't hurt too. Good luck
